Population Overview
Centre Grove CDP is a small community located in New Jersey. The total population is 1,371. It ranks as the 521st most populous out of 700 cities and towns in New Jersey.
Age Demographics
The median age in Centre Grove CDP is 38.6 years. This is 4% lower than the state median of 40.1 years.
Economy, Income & Housing
The median household income in Centre Grove CDP is $104,028. This is 3% higher than the state median of $101,050. Compared to the national median of $78,538, household income here is 32% higher. The poverty rate stands at 4.9%. This is 50% lower than the state poverty rate of 9.8%. This exceptionally low poverty rate indicates strong economic prosperity across the community. The unemployment rate is 3.2%. This is 48% lower than the state rate of 6.2%. The median home value is $209,300. Housing costs are 51% lower than the state median of $427,600. With a home-value-to-income ratio of just 2.0x, Centre Grove CDP is one of the most affordable housing markets in the area. 91.2% of occupied housing units are owner-occupied. This homeownership rate is 43% higher than the state average of 63.7%.
Race & Ethnicity
The largest racial or ethnic group in Centre Grove CDP is White (non-Hispanic), making up 80.5% of the population. Black or African American residents account for 7.1%. The White (non-Hispanic) population is significantly higher than the state average (80.5% vs 51.9%). The Hispanic or Latino population (5.5%) is well below the state average of 21.9%.
Education
31.6%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. This is 26% lower than the state rate of 42.9%. Nationally, 35.0% of adults hold at least a bachelor's degree. The high school graduation rate (or equivalent) is 90.6%.
Data Sources & Methodology
All demographic data for Centre Grove CDP, New Jersey is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against New Jersey state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 700 Census-designated places in New Jersey. For official data, visit data.census.gov.
